An Index Theorem for Loop Spaces

Abstract

We formulate and prove an index theorem for loop spaces of compact manifolds in the framework of KKKK-theory. It is a strong candidate for the noncommutative geometrical definition (or the analytic counterpart) of the Witten genus. In order to find out an "appropriate form" of the index theorem to formulate a loop space version, we formulate and prove an equivariant index theorem for non-compact manifolds equipped with S1S^1-actions with compact fixed-point sets. In order to formulate it, we use a ring of formal power series.
